SOFTBALL ADDS MENDOZA FOR 2007 SEASON

MOBILE, Ala. ? University of South Alabama softball head coach Becky Clark announced Monday the signing of Carolina Mendoza.

 

During her time at Colegio Internacioual, Mendoza set records for slugging percentage (1.241), stolen bases (9), home runs (11) and batting average (.552). She was named Player of the Year on the Ecuador National Team in 1996, ’97, ’99, ’02, ’03 and ’05, as well as, being named team captain five years.

 

Carolina is a great sign for our program,” said Clark. “Defensively she has great hands and instincts and is going to give us some more athleticism up the middle. Offensively I expect her to be a major contributor and a solid presence at the plate. Like the other signees before her, I believe she will be great for our softball program, as well as, the University of South Alabama.”

 

Mendoza joins Katie McGuire (Thompson HS), Autumn Hudson (Gulf Coast CC), and Katie Veres and Ashley Elmore (Wallace State CC) and Jenny Stevens (Jackson HS) and fellow late signees Julie Ann Morton (Morris HS), Beth Pilgrim (Escambia HS), Amanda Leggett (Pensacola JC), Tara Donaldson (Auburn), Linden Jones, Kristen Hayes and Corey Race (University of Mobile) and Shay Sullivan (Lipscomb University) in the inaugural Jaguar recruiting class.
